Genetics for the Public's Health - A Satellite Broadcast
Tuesday, November 6, 2001
1pm-4pm EST
Faculty from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), the
Wadsworth Center, New York State Department of
Health, the University of California at Los Angeles (UCLA), and Xenon
Genetics will discuss the use of new genetic tests in
medical management and public health decision making. Learn how your
personal and professional life will be affected by today's
research discoveries, as information derived from the human genome is
integrated into clinical and public health practice. A
question and answer session will enable participants nationwide to pose
questions to panelists via toll-free telephone. No
